Influencer calls whole tomato at Las Vegas restaurant iconic while others are deeply confused: So dystopian

Influencers need to ketchup with the times.A woman took great pleasure in being served a whole tomato and lemon in place of a bread basket at a restaurant, and now “influencer culture” is being roasted on social media.“OK, so we’re at LPM in Vegas and they give out tomatoes and lemon as your little bread at the table,” Cassidy Miller said in a TikTok video.“Which is great for me because I’m gluten-free, so this is, like, iconic.”The New Jersey resident then filmed as she sliced a piece of the tomato, squeezed the lemon on it, then topped it with olive oil, salt and pepper.As she took a bite into the tomato served at the French Mediterranean restaurant, her eyes widened in euphoria.“Wow.
So fresh, so good,” she said in the clip, which has amassed 5 million views.The video has received thousands of comments — mainly by people in disbelief that Miller would be that excited over being served a tomato.“If someone brought me a tomato in place of bread, I would contact my lawyer immediately,” someone commented.“Do they let you wash the dishes for the full experience?” one person joked.“Acting like tomato slices are a delicacy is frying me,” another wrote.“They gave y’all a Great Depression snack,” a user quipped.“Wait, I’m actually so fascinated by this video.Is this a joke?
